Thinning and Pruning Field Day offered in Orofino
The University of Idaho Clearwater County Extension Office will offer a Thinning and Pruning Field Day on Friday, April 9.
This program will feature two-three hours indoors discussing basic concepts of thinning and pruning, followed by a hands-on field tour in the afternoon to learn about thinning, pruning, forest genetics, and chainsaw safety firsthand.
The class will be held from 8 a.m. to 5 p.m. at the University of Idaho Clearwater County Extension Office meeting room, 2200 Michigan Ave. in Orofino.
